Rob Sutter – Award-Winning Realtor® in North Carolina

Turning Real Estate Dreams into Reality

Rob Sutter, the driving force behind The Sutter Realty Group, is a standout Realtor® based in Chapel Hill, NC. Originally from Berkshire County, Massachusetts, Rob holds a B.S. in Biochemistry and Molecular Biology from Drew University. His journey led him to North Carolina, where he discovered a vibrant community and a passion for real estate.

The Research Triangle is an eight-county region in the Piedmont of North Carolina comprising the Raleigh and Durham–Chapel Hill metropolitan areas. In addition to its desirable residential communities, The Triangle is primarily focused on education, business and research, as the name implies.…
